Output 8fd95c37d026a85b04e4b37e6e08dc152bc48465643c74ec0d959b0c4421ee40:0

value
9417000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c52bb81488c50871934127918eb0c98179b3ef0 OP_EQUAL
address
3FwaSpX6QBfCpugdcaiZHASto8UqvkAHcM
transaction
8fd95c37d026a85b04e4b37e6e08dc152bc48465643c74ec0d959b0c4421ee40
spent
true